Key Developments in South Korea Health and Fitness Club Market Sector
- April 2024: Gangnam District Office opened a "smart fitness center" for elderly residents in Seoul, South Korea, equipped with artificial intelligence-based fitness equipment that helps users monitor and adjust their exerted force during strength training.
- March 2024: South Korean–US actor Ma Dong Seok launched a new gym named Big Punch Boxing Club across South Korea, with a notable presence at the opening by South Korean rapper SUGA from the BTS band.
- June 2021: Jamaica Fitness opened a new Gangnam BangBang facility in South Korea, enhancing its fitness facilities, instructor pool, and program offerings, solidifying its reputation as a high-satisfaction gym for its members.

8. Can you provide examples of recent developments in the market?
April 2024: Gangnam District Office opened a "smart fitness center" for elderly residents in Seoul, South Korea. The new gym center is filled with artificial intelligence-based fitness equipment. The smart fitness center is filled with AI-powered monitors installed in strength training machines, which helps users continuously monitor their exerted force during strength training and adjust the weight of the devices accordingly.
